1. Adrien Nussenbaum is a co-founder of Mirakl

According to Crunchbase, Adrien Nussenbaum is not only the CEO of Mirakl, but he is also a co-founder of the company. He is a part-owner of the business where he serves as an executive. He splits the responsibilities for leadership of Mirakl with his co-founding partner, which makes him a co-CEO. 2. He founded a gaming company

Mirakl isn’t the first company that Mr. Nussenbaum has launched. He is a serial co-founder who has also founded a company called SplitGames. He has more than a decade of experience in entrepreneurship and business development. This is in part, the reason for the huge success of Mirakl today.

3. He started his career in finance

Adrien Nussenbaum began his professional career in the financial industry. He was hired to work for an institution called PARABIS. His job title was an investment banker. He worked for the company at its Hong Kong location. This immediately gave him experience in international finance. It was a good start for his career in the business sector. Adrien gained valuable experience in the field of investments while gaining experience working within an international cultural business environment.

4. Adrien advanced to management

After gaining experience in the financial industry with PARABIS, Adrien Nussenbaum moved on to another position. He was hired to work with DELOITTE’s restructuring team as a manager. Adrien worked with a variety of retailers as an advisor, helping them complete their turnaround processes. He was building an impressive resume and adding to his skill set with each new job.

5. Nussenbaum is a serial entrepreneur

Before Adrien Nussenbaum founded Mirakl, he worked with a partner to co-found an instant messaging solution. The name of the company was ALL INSTANT. It was headquartered in New York and provided solutions for corporations. This was in his earlier years, and it was his first entrepreneurial endeavor. He also served as the chief financial officer of the company. He sold the company in 2003 for an undisclosed amount. 6. He was co-head of FNAC.COM

Before co-founding Mirakl, Adrien was hired to be the co-head of the Marketplace business unit at a company called FNAC.COM. The company maintained a focus on the development of a seller program with content syndication deals. Its mission was to increase the product offering. FNAC is the company that acquired its company SplitGames in 2008. He was asked to stay on with the firm while making the transition of SplitGames to its new parent company, which speaks highly of the leadership of the acquiring company’s respect for his leadership abilities. The terms of the acquisition were not publicly disclosed, but it is assumed that SplitGames continued to function as a subsidiary.

7. Adrien Nussenbaum has an international education

According to LinkedIn, Adrien attended college at HEC Paris in 1997. He studied finance and management. He graduated with his master’s o science from the institution in 2001. He also attended NYU’s Stern School of Business for one year in 2001, where he earned his Master’s of Business Administration in Finance.

9. He owned FINEDEV in Paris

Adrien Nussenbaum launched a company called FINEDEV in January of 2011. The business’s headquarters is in Paris, France. He assisted with the fundraising, sales process, strategic consulting, and private investments. His focus was on startup companies. He was only active in the enterprise for one month, but it shows his initiative for trying new things. Adrien used his knowledge and experience to start new businesses.
